Sweep NURBS from Dynamic Spline problem
by
Corrado Carlevaro
on May 26, 2011 at 3:23:17 pm
Hi,
I'm trying to animate with dynamics kind of algae/seaweed/tentacles etc., fixed from the bottom and swinging in the air.
I tried with Spline Dynamics (with a Constraint Tag at the bottom) inside a Sweep NURBS but the base of NURBS is rotating on itself along the Y axis, not "rooted" to the ground.
The same happens if I use a Spline Wrap deformer referencing the Dynamic Spline.
This is NOT happening with the Hair Object, the guides are rooted in the ground, but the problem with this is that then I can generate just instances of singles meshes and not complex objects, e.g. nested or animated.
